Itinerary

Day 1: Arrival in Quito

Day 2: Quito City Tour

Day 3: Quito - Ilaló - Otavalo
This two hour walk takes us up to 3,200 metres altitude, from where we can enjoy gorgeous views over Quito and the "Avenue of the Volcanoes", inlcuding the peaks of Pichincha, Cotopaxi, Antisana, Cayambe and the Ilinizas.

Day 4: Otavalo - Cuicocha
The deep blue Cuicocha Lake, at 3,400 metres, is set in a volcanic crater with two emerald green islands and offers visitors stunning views across the province of Imbabura and the surrounding snow-capped volcanoes. The hike around the lake takes around four to five hours.

Day 5: Otavalo - San Pablo - Zuleta
From San Pablo lagoon we will walk to the town of Zuleta though the indigenous lands of Imbabura, where family-run farms cling to the slopes of Cayambe, Imbabura and Cusín Volcanoes.

Day 6: Tram ride and Peguche
From Ibarra we will ride on the roof of the "Autoferro" tram towards Lita, passing incredible views and tropical vegetation.

Day 7: Otavalo Market - Quito
Visit one of the largest and most colourful markets in South America! You will find textiles, fruit, crafts and animals for sale at this market, which occupies a huge part of the city of Otavalo.

Day 8: Cotopaxi - Quilotoa
Cotopaxi National Park, home to llamas and wild horses, surrounds Cotopaxi Volcano, Ecuador´s second-highest peak at 5,897 metres. We will ascend to the volcano´s refuge, at 4,800 metres, and from there head towards the glacier.

Day 9: Quilotoa - Baños
This magnificent region of the Western Andes takes us past numerous indigenous towns, lush mountainsides and desert-like plains, to the area´s most spectacular sight - Quilotoa crater lake.

Day 10: Baños
Located at a subtropical 1,800 metres altitude, at the foot of the smoke-spewing Tungurahua Volcano, Baños is a perfect place for relaxing. We will visit sugarcane plantations, the cathedral, wood and tagua workshops, a zoo with tropical wildlife and of course the natural thermal pools that give the town its name.

Days 11-13: The Amazon
We will spend a day travelling to our jungle lodge , from where we can enjoy treks and canoe rides through the Amazon rainforest, as we observe wildlife, spectacular scenery and medicinal plants. We will also visit a wildlife rescue center, an indigenous cabin and cool off with a swim in the river.
